<ralf@linux-mips.org> (03/11/08 1.1416)
[netdrvr pcnet32] add missing pci_dma_sync_single

a patch for the pcnet32.c driver which adds a missing call to
pci_dma_sync_single. If a received packet is smaller than rx_copybreak
the pcnet driver will recycle the receive buffer which requires calling
pci_dma_sync_single. Patch is against 2.6 but I it's also needed in 2.4.

Without that call the processor might still have old stale data in
the data cache when the processor accesses the recycled buffer.
